Optimizing Honey Boho for Commercial Success
To maximize the commercial potential of Honey Boho, consider pairing it with a clean sans serif font for body text or secondary details. This combination creates a balanced hierarchy where the expressive script captures attention, while the neutral partner ensures information is easy to read. For instance, you might use Honey Boho for the headline "Handmade with Love" and pair it with a simple geometric sans serif for the ingredients list on a product label. This strategy enhances readability and prevents the design from becoming too busy, which is a common pitfall when working with display fonts. Additionally, always verify the included file formats and alternate characters to ensure you have all the necessary glyphs for multilingual support if you plan to sell globally. Understanding the licensing terms for commercial use is also vital; ensure your purchase covers the creation of physical products, templates, and digital downloads so you can sell with confidence.
Practical Tips for Cutting and Printing with Honey Boho
When preparing Honey Boho for production, keep in mind that its handwritten style benefits from generous spacing to maintain its airy, friendly vibe. For small stickers or intricate cut files, test the kerning closely to ensure the letters do not touch, which could cause tearing or smudging during the cutting process. If you are printing on paper or cardstock, choose a high-resolution output to capture the fine details of the strokes, as low-resolution files can make the font look jagged and unprofessional. Mockups are incredibly useful for visualizing how Honey Boho performs on different materials; try placing the font on a mockup of a mason jar or a wedding invite to gauge its real-world impact. By paying attention to these technical details, you ensure that the final product matches the high standards expected by buyers of premium fonts and design assets.
